Best Gwinn Public Elementary Schools (2026)

For the 2026 school year, there are 3 public elementary schools serving 892 students in Gwinn, MI.
The top-ranked public elementary schools in Gwinn, MI are George D Gilbert Elementary School, Ki Sawyer Elementary School and Gwinn Middlehigh School. Overall testing rank is based on a school's combined math and reading proficiency test score ranking.
Gwinn, MI public elementary schools have an average math proficiency score of 21% (versus the Michigan public elementary school average of 35%), and reading proficiency score of 29% (versus the 44% statewide average). Elementary schools in Gwinn have an average ranking of 2/10, which is in the bottom 50% of Michigan public elementary schools.
Minority enrollment is 18%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which is less than the Michigan public elementary school average of 38% (majority Black).
